Топ-7 исправлений ошибки BSOD Hal.dll [Пошаговое руководство] [Советы по MiniTool]
Top 7 Fixes Hal Dll Bsod Error
Резюме :
Вас смущает проблема с BSOD hal.dll в Windows 10? Вы знаете, как исправить ошибки в hal.dll? Вот, MiniTool проанализирует возможные причины ошибки hal.dll и предложит вам несколько эффективных методов.
Быстрая навигация:
Причины ошибок, связанных с Hal.dll
Ошибки Hal.dll могут возникнуть в Windows 7/8/10 и Виндоус виста с разными сообщениями об ошибках. Вот некоторые распространенные сообщения об ошибках BSOD hal.dll.
- Не удалось запустить Windows, потому что следующий файл отсутствует или поврежден: C: Windows system32 hal.dll. Пожалуйста, переустановите копию указанного выше файла.
- Не удается найти Windows System32 hal.dll
- C: Windows System32 Hal.dll отсутствует или поврежден: переустановите копию указанного выше файла.
Что вызывает ошибку hal.dll в Windows 10? Есть несколько факторов, которые могут вызвать ошибку. Например, файл hal.dll отсутствует или поврежден вирусом или вредоносными программами. Если ваш компьютер случайно выключился, вы также можете столкнуться с этой неприятной проблемой.
Кроме того, поврежденный жесткий диск также ответственен за ошибку отсутствия hal dll. Однако такая возможность встречается редко. Ошибка, возникающая до сих пор в Windows 7/8/10 и Windows Vista, в основном вызвана проблемами с главным загрузочным кодом.
Наконечник: Однако, если ошибка возникает у вас, необходимо попробовать и проверить, не является ли поврежденный жесткий диск причиной ошибки.Теперь вы должны выбрать следующие исправления, чтобы решить ошибку BSOD hal.dll.
Исправление 1: проверьте порядок загрузки в BIOS
Если диск, на котором хранится ваша часто используемая копия Windows, не установлен в качестве первой загрузки, вы можете столкнуться с ошибкой hal.dll.
Наконечник: Если вы установили внутренний жесткий диск, подключили внешний жесткий диск и изменили BIOS, вам лучше проверить это.Поскольку вы видите синий экран и не можете загрузить компьютер в обычном режиме, вам необходимо загрузить компьютер с помощью Ремонтный диск Windows 10 или USB-накопитель . Вот как это сделать.
Шаг 1: Подключите диск восстановления Windows или USB-накопитель к целевому компьютеру и нажмите удалять , F2 или другие необходимые ключи для входа в BIOS.
Шаг 2: После этого перейдите к Загрузки вкладка в соответствии с данной инструкцией внизу Утилита настройки PhoenixBIOS страница.
Шаг 3: Проверьте правильность порядка загрузки. Если нет, вы можете нажать вверх или же стрелка вниз , чтобы выбрать правильный загрузочный диск, а затем нажмите + или же - ключ поставить выбранный диск в первую очередь. После этого нажмите кнопку F10 (доступно для Windows 10), чтобы подтвердить операцию, а затем нажмите Войти чтобы операция вступила в силу.
Исправление 2: запустить тест поверхности
Хотя ситуация, когда поврежденный жесткий диск вызывает ошибку BSOD hal.dll, встречается редко, это все еще возможно. Чтобы проверить, есть ли на жестком диске поврежденные сектора, вы можете использовать профессиональные инструменты, такие как MiniTool Partition Wizard.
В Тест поверхности Функция этого программного обеспечения позволяет легко сканировать жесткий диск на наличие битых секторов. Это фантастический менеджер разделов, позволяющий удалить файлы навсегда , проверьте производительность вашего диска, проверьте и исправьте ошибки файловой системы и отформатировать жесткий диск и т.д. Если вы хотите получить его сейчас, просто нажмите кнопку ниже.
Совет: Поскольку ваш компьютер не может нормально загрузиться, вам необходимо использовать загрузочный носитель через MiniTool Partition Wizard Pro Edition. Бесплатная версия не поддерживает эту функцию, что можно увидеть в сравнение изданий .
купить сейчас
Шаг 1: Загрузите и установите MiniTool Partition Pro Edition на другой компьютер, который может нормально работать. Затем создайте загрузочный носитель с программным обеспечением. Здесь, поскольку вам нужно использовать носитель для неисправного компьютера, вы должны выбрать USB-накопитель или файл ISO при определении местоположения носителя.
Наконечник: Если вы выбрали файл ISO, вам необходимо записать его на внешние устройства, такие как жесткий диск, USB-накопитель, компакт-диск.Шаг 2: Затем подключите подготовленный загрузочный носитель к неисправному компьютеру. Теперь перезагрузите компьютер с носителя и установите его в качестве первой загрузки в BIOS.
Шаг 3: Следуйте инструкциям на экране, чтобы перейти к MiniTool PE Погрузчик страница. Затем откроется страница запуска Мастера создания разделов MiniTool. Вы можете войти в основной интерфейс этого программного обеспечения, просто щелкнув Запустить приложение вариант.
Шаг 4: После выбора целевого диска (обычно диска C) нажмите Тест поверхности вариант на левой панели действий.
Шаг 5: Во всплывающем окне нажмите на Начать сейчас провести операцию. Затем программа просканирует диск на наличие поврежденных секторов. Вам просто нужно терпеливо дождаться завершения всего процесса. Если в результате сканирования есть красные блоки, это означает, что на вашем жестком диске есть битые сектора.
Как бороться с этими плохими секторами? Вы найдете ответы в этом посте: Что делать, если на жестком диске в Windows 10/8/7 обнаружены битые сектора
Исправление 3: обновите загрузочный код тома
Если загрузочный код тома поврежден или поврежден, вы можете увидеть ошибку hal.dll. В этом случае вам следует обновить загрузочный код тома (VBC), чтобы использовать BOOTMGR для исправления ошибки.
Чтобы обновить загрузочный код тома через Командная строка , вам необходимо перезагрузить компьютер с помощью установочного диска Windows 10 и установить его в качестве верхнего порядка загрузки в BIOS.
Шаг 1: Идти к Среда восстановления Windows следуя инструкциям на экране.
Шаг 2: Выбрать Устранение неполадок > Командная строка .
Шаг 3: В окне подсказки введите bootsect / NT60 система и нажмите на Войти .
После этого программа обновит загрузочный код тома на разделе, который используется для загрузки Windows 10, до BOOTMGR автоматически. Тогда вы получите следующую информацию.
Наконечник: Если вам не удается обновить загрузочный код тома и вы получаете сообщения об ошибках или эта операция не работает, попробуйте вместо этого ввести bootsect / nt60 all.
Исправление 4: проверьте файловую систему
Файловая система жесткого диска может быть повреждена или повреждена из-за таких проблем, как ошибки записи на диск, перебои в подаче электроэнергии, вирусные атаки и т. Д. В этом случае операционная система не может найти hal.dll для нормальной загрузки и загрузки ПК с Windows. .
Следовательно, необходимо проверить целостность вашей файловой системы или нет. MiniTool Partition Wizard позволяет легко выполнить эту задачу. Точно так же вы также должны получить его профессиональную версию.
купить сейчас
Шаг 1: Перезагрузите компьютер с загрузочного носителя, который был создан заранее, а затем запустите MiniTool Partition Wizard Pro Edition. Щелкните правой кнопкой мыши целевой диск и выберите Проверить файловую систему во всплывающем меню.
Шаг 2: в Проверить файловую систему окно, выберите Проверить и исправить обнаруженные ошибки вариант и нажмите на Начало . Затем дождитесь окончания процесса.
После завершения всего процесса обнаруженная ошибка файловой системы на целевом жестком диске может быть исправлена. Затем вы можете проверить, сохраняется ли ошибка hal.dll.
Вам также может быть интересно это: 7 исправлений ошибки файловой системы - 2147219196 [исправление 3 работает хорошо]
Исправление 5: восстановление Boot.ini
Файл boot.ini используется Windows для настройки и отображения параметров операционной системы. Если вы получаете ошибку, связанную с boot.ini, например, BSOD hal.dll, и файл hal.dll не поврежден или поврежден, виноват файл boot.ini. Вот шаги для восстановления boot.ini.
Шаг 1: Вставьте установочный диск Windows и перезагрузите неисправный компьютер.
Шаг 2: Нажмите Del / F2, чтобы убедиться, что Windows настроена на загрузку с диска.
Шаг 3: Закройте редактор и загрузитесь с установочного диска Windows. Когда Windows загрузится, нажмите р войти в Консоль восстановления .
Шаг 4: Тип attrib -h -r -s c: boot.ini в поднятом окне и ударил Войти . Если появляется ошибка «Параметр неправильный», проигнорируйте ее и продолжайте.
Шаг 5: Введите следующие команды одну за другой. После ввода одной команды нажмите Войти продолжать.
- дель c: boot.ini
- bootcfg / перестроить
- и
- Windows
- / fastdetect
- Fixboot
- И
- Выход
Шаг 6: Перезагрузите компьютер и проверьте, исправлена ли проблема BSOD hal.dll.
Исправление 6: восстановление системных файлов через SFC
Вы можете использовать утилиту SFC (System File Checker) для сканирования и исправления поврежденных системных файлов в Windows 7/8/10 и Windows Vista. Перед тем, как приступить к следующим шагам, вам необходимо загрузить компьютер с установочного диска Windows.
Шаг 1: После выбора правильного языка, времени и ввода с клавиатуры нажмите Почини свой компьютер в следующий страница.
Шаг 2: Идти к Устранение неполадок> Командная строка . (это доступно для Windows 10)
Наконечник: В разных версиях Windows могут быть разные шаги для открытия страницы командной строки.Шаг 3: На странице подсказки введите команду sfc / scannow и ударил Войти .
Исправление 7. Выполните чистую установку ОС Windows
Если все вышеперечисленные решения не помогли исправить ошибку hal.dll, попробуйте провести чистую установку ОС Windows. То есть все на вашем жестком диске будет удалено, и будет установлена совершенно новая копия Windows.
Вы можете прочитать этот пост, чтобы получить более подробную информацию о сбросе Windows 10, чистой установке и новом запуске и о том, как выполнить чистую установку Windows 10.
Сброс Windows 10 VS Чистая установка VS Новый запуск, подробности здесь!Сброс Windows 10 VS чистая установка VS новый запуск, в чем разница? Прочтите этот пост, чтобы узнать о них и выбрать подходящий для переустановки ОС.
Читать больше